“The military used sexual violence as a weapon of war”: The Mujeres Achí case advances

As in the case of the women of Sepur Sarco and other historical processes, this trial reveals the use of sexual violence as a mechanism of subjugation and oppression of women and their communities by the Guatemalan armed forces. The trial is expected to end at the end of March.

The occurrences of Rodrigo Chaves: Costa Rica eliminates comprehensive sexual education in schools and colleges

The Higher Council of Education eliminated the programs aimed at supporting sexual and emotional education. This was done without having a substantive discussion on the topic, ignoring technical, professional, and legal criteria.

Uncertainty over historical archives of Nicaragua, El Salvador, and Honduras raises alarms

Historical archives are the raw material of any history professional or researcher, as defined by Héctor Lindo, who regrets that new generations have difficulties accessing key inputs for their training and that they can see their careers paralyzed by the lack of access to historical documents.
